Food Security Sector SO1 Gap Analysis – August 2022

In August 2022, Sector partners assisted 2,238,022 people with food assistance (through in-kind or CVA) in the three most affected North-East states of Nigeria. The largest gap identified remains in Adamawa State (88%), followed by Yobe State (43%), and Borno State (26%). This implies significant food assistance gaps in BAY states. The food assistance gap in the BAY states is 1.9 million people.
